Forename Fan

Worldwide, Fan (Fan China Hong Kong Malaysia United States Taiwan, ファン Japan, فان Iraq Egypt Sudan Saudi Arabia Syria, and others...) is a common gender-neutral first name. The forename Fan is habitual in Macao, where it is quite a common epicene name, Hong Kong, and Singapore, where it is quite a rare epicene name. In absolute terms, it is the most numerous in China, Indonesia, and Hong Kong. More frequently, Fan is the last name as well as the forename.
